Official abstract text for this publication.
An inkjet recording apparatus includes an ink tank forming an ink chamber and including an injection inlet, a cover, a cover sensor, a recording head, a monitor, and a controller. The cover is movable between a covering position and an exposing position. The cover sensor is positioned to output a signal depending on the position of the cover. The controller controls operation of the recording head, the monitor. The controller receives either a first positional signal or a second positional signal of the cover sensor, and based on receipt of the first positional signal after receipt of the second positional signal from the cover sensor, performs a decision process deciding whether an operation regarding ink injection into the ink chamber is completed.

What is claimed is: 1 . An inkjet recording apparatus comprising: an ink tank forming an ink chamber and including an injection inlet; a recording head configured to eject ink in the ink chamber to record an image on a sheet; a cover movable between a covered position and an exposed position; a cover sensor positioned to output a signal depending on the position of the cover; and a monitor; an operation panel configured to receive user input; and a controller configured to control operation of the recording head, the monitor, and the operation panel, the controller configured to: receive either a first positional signal or a second positional signal from the cover sensor; based on receipt of the first positional signal after receipt of the second positional signal from the cover sensor, perform a decision process deciding whether an operation regarding ink injection into the ink chamber is completed, the first positional signal from the cover sensor being positioned in the covered position in which the cover covers the injection inlet and the second positional signal from the cover sensor corresponding to the cover being positioned in the exposed position in which the injection inlet is exposed; and, based on decision that the operation regarding the ink injection into the ink chamber is completed, control the monitor to perform an inquiry processing to display inquiry information on the monitor regarding whether the ink injection into the ink chamber is completed and control the operation panel to allow receipt at the operation panel of a response to the inquiry information. 2 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to further perform, based on receipt of the second positional signal from the cover sensor, restricting discharging ink from the recording head. 3 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 2 , wherein the controller is configured to further perform, based on either complement of the inquiry processing or the decision that the operation regarding of the ink injection into the ink chamber is completed, cancelling the restriction of ink discharging. 4 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to further perform counting an amount of ink discharged from the recording head, the counted amount of ink corresponding to an amount of ink corresponding to an amount of ink discharged during a period from the receipt of the second positional signal until the receipt of the first positional signal. 5 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 4 , wherein the controller is configured to perform in the decision process based on counted amount of ink is greater than the prescribed value, deciding that the operation regarding the ink injection into the ink chamber is completed. 6 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 5 , wherein the controller is configured to perform in the decision process based on the counted amount of ink is less than or equal to a prescribed value, deciding that the operation regarding ink injection into the ink chamber is not completed. 7 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 4 , wherein the controller is configured to further perform initializing the counted amount of ink to an initial value based on receipt of a first response to the inquiry information in the inquiry processing, the first response corresponding to completion of the ink injection. 8 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 4 , wherein the controller is configured to perform, in the decision process, based on the counted amount of ink at a time when the receipt of the first positional signal different form the initial value, deciding that the operation regarding ink injection into the ink chamber is completed. 9 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 8 , wherein the controller is configured to perform, in the decision process, based on the counted amount of ink at the time when the receipt of the first positional signal equal to the initial value, deciding that the operation regarding ink injection into the ink chamber is not completed. 10 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to further perform counting an elapsed time, the elapsed time corresponding to a period from the receipt of the second positional signal until the receipt of the first positional signal. 11 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 10 , wherein the controller is configured to perform, in the decision process, based on the elapsed time being greater than a threshold time, deciding that the operation regarding ink injection into the ink chamber is completed. 12 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 11 , wherein the controller is configured to perform, in the decision process, based on the elapsed time being less than or equal to the threshold time, deciding that the operation regarding ink injection into the ink chamber is not completed. 13 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 4 , wherein the controller is configured to further perform, based on the counted amount discharged ink having reached a threshold value, controlling the monitor to perform notification process to display a notification on the monitor. 14 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 13 , wherein the notification includes a prompt to inject ink into the ink chamber. 15 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 13 , wherein the controller is configured to perform, based on the receipt of the first positional signal, controlling the monitor to perform the notification process. 16 . The inkjet recording apparatus according to claim 1 , further comprising a plurality of ink chambers and a plurality of injection inlets, each of the plurality of ink chambers associated with a different one of the plurality of injection inlets. 17 . A method for controlling operation of an inkjet recording apparatus, the method comprising: receiving either a first positional signal or a second positional signal of a cover sensor positioned to output a signal depending on the position of a cover, the first positional signal from the cover sensor corresponding to the cover being positioned in which the cover covers an injection inlet associated with an ink chambers of inkjet recording apparatus and the second positional signal from the cover sensor corresponding to the cover being positioned in which injection inlets are exposed; based on receipt of a first positional signal after receipt of a second positional signal, performing a decision process deciding whether an operation regarding ink injection into the ink chamber is completed; and, based on decision that the operation regarding the ink injection into the ink chamber is completed, controlling the monitor to perform an inquiry process to display inquiry information on the monitor regarding whether the ink injection into the ink chamber is completed and controlling the operation panel to allow receipt at the operation panel of a response to the inquiry information.
